您的位置:首页 > 数据库

Ado.net 数据库读取文件

2016-07-23 15:42 330 查看
string connStr = ConfigurationManager.ConnectionStrings["connStr"].ConnectionString;
using(SqlConnection conn = new SqlConnection(connStr))
{
using(SqlDataAdapter adapter = new SqlDataAdapter("select * from userInfo", conn))
{
DataTable da = new DataTable();
adapter.Fill(da);
if (da.Rows.Count > 0)
{
StringBuilder sb = new StringBuilder();
foreach (DataRow row in da.Rows)
{
sb.AppendFormat("<tr><td>{0}</td><td>{1}</td><td>{2}</td></tr>", row["ID"].ToString(), row["Name"].ToString(), row["UserName"].ToString());
}

//读取模板文件,替换占位符
string filePath = context.Request.MapPath("UserInfoList.html");
string fileContent = File.ReadAllText(filePath);
fileContent = fileContent.Replace("要替换的占位符", sb.ToString());
context.Response.Write(fileContent);
}
else
{
context.Response.Write("暂无数据");
}
}
}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: